Sr SAP SCM Analyst

Sr SAP SCM Analyst

CompanyMedline
LocationVernon Hills, IL, USA
Salary$110240 – $165360
TypeFull-Time
DegreesBachelor’s, Master’s
Experience LevelSenior

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s or Master’s Deg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Business Administration, or a related field or equivalent experience
  • 5+ years of SAP Supply Chain Management module experience is required
  • 5+ years of experience in functional software design is necessary
  • Strong knowledge of interfaces with other SAP and non-SAP systems
  • Good experience in Logistic Execution and Transportation
  • 2+ years of SAP system implementation (configuration) experience in MM modules is required
  • Experience in analyzing processes, making recommendations for changes to support improvements and translating them into SAP solutions that enable the organization to achieve its goals
  • Excellent organization, communication, analysis, and planning skills
  • Working experience within a variety of technical architectures
  • Work experience within an environment following a structured SDLC methodology
  • Proven experience of testing complex test plans/scripts

Responsibilities

  • Understand Medline business processes in Supply chain and related areas
  • Interact with Medline Business users to understand and document functional/non-functional requirements
  • Convert documented requirements and proposed solutions into solid systems designs to be developed by others, in India or the US
  • Analyze the design to understand areas of impact and develop test plans accordingly
  • Work with developers to understand the designs and validate the software solution will satisfy the business needs
  • Assist Development staff in development and unit testing of these designs, regardless of development language
  • Develop test strategies and execute application test plans
  • Assist Testing staff in executing test plans
  • Troubleshoot reported systems issues, using data analysis and debugging tools as necessary
  • Serve as primary contact for handling support issues during Medline India business hours
  • Provide feedback to the Development team and Functional team to ensure the work is carried out in accordance with the schedule and the quality requirements
  • Communicate regularly with Configuration Analysts at Corporate Headquarters to stay current on new and changed business processes and systems enhancements
  • Provide regular verbal communication and clear written documentation on all assignments
  • Provide estimates and feedback to the Software Development Manager for project scheduling purposes
